VueScan 8.3.68 Breaks the 32-bit Barrier

Hamrick Software, the developer of VueScan, the world's most widely used scanning software, has announced support for very high resolution scans that exceed the capacity of older 32-bit software. This unique offering allows very large scans to be made by any scanner.

Phoenix, AZ (PRWEB) September 28, 2006 -- Hamrick Software, the developer of VueScan, the world's most widely used scanning software, has announced support for very high resolution scans that exceed the capacity of older 32-bit software. This essentially means that users can now make very large scans. This is a huge benefit to users, as there is no other software available that can do this.

"Today's scanners are capable of very high resolutions - 4800 dpi and beyond. All other scanner programs are limited to scan sizes of 2 GBytes, which makes it impossible to make high resolution scans of larger film sizes," noted Ed Hamrick, President of Hamrick Software.

"VueScan 8.3.68 breaks this 32-bit barrier, allowing full use of scanners that can produce more than 2 GBytes of scanner data. For instance, this allows a new level of realism when scanning 4x5 inch film at 6400 dpi, producing 6 GBytes of image data. This new level of realism exceeds the resolution of any digital camera by at least a factor of 100."

VueScan is available for Mac OS X, Windows and Linux. VueScan offers options for scanning faded slides and prints and automatically adjusts images to optimum color balance that reduces the need to manually do this in Photoshop. It includes built-in IT8 color calibration of scanners, producing colors that look true to life, batch scanning and other advanced and powerful scanning and productivity features, including PDF output.

VueScan is available in two editions, Standard Edition ($49.95 USD) and Professional Edition ($89.95). The Professional Edition adds unlimited free upgrades, advanced IT8 color calibration and support for raw scan files. Multi-user licenses are available. Based in Phoenix, AZ, Hamrick Software was founded in 1991. Its first product was VuePrint, an easy to use JPEG viewer for Windows that for many years was the recommended image viewer for AOL, with more than 100,000 users. In 1998, the company first released VueScan, a program for scanning with flatbed and film scanners, there are now more than 130,000 users all over the world.
